The Denver Broncos collected a comeback victory on Sunday on the road against the Los Angeles Chargers and improved their record to 4-6. There was plenty of good to go around, but also some questionable moments and marks as well in the win.

Discussing the win is Broncos Blitz podcast host Ronnie Kohrt, who goes over the good, the bad and the ugly from the win.

From Phillip Lindsay to Case Keenum, the Broncos final drive to Von Miller‘s huge interception, Kohrt covers the game and gets fan reaction on social media from the latest Broncos win.
